Skandha 6 · Chapter 11

The Ordinance of the Duties of the Yugas

Verse 1 (devibhagavatam.6.11.1)

जनमेजय उवाच । भारावतारणार्थाय कथितं जन्म कृष्णयोः । संशयोऽयं द्विजश्रेष्ठ हृदये मम तिष्ठति

janamejaya uvāca | bhārāvatāraṇārthāya kathitaṁ janma kṛṣṇayoḥ | saṁśayo'yaṁ dvijaśreṣṭha hṛdaye mama tiṣṭhati

Janamejaya said: 'You have told of the birth of the two Krishnas — Krishna and Arjuna — for the purpose of relieving the earth's burden; but this doubt, O finest of the twice-born, still remains in my heart.'

Verse 2 (devibhagavatam.6.11.2)

पृथिवी गोस्वरूपेण ब्रह्माणं शरणं गता । द्वापरान्तेऽतिदीनार्ता गुरुभारप्रपीडिता

pṛthivī gosvarūpeṇa brahmāṇaṁ śaraṇaṁ gatā | dvāparānte'tidīnārtā gurubhāraprapīḍitā

'At the end of Dvapara, the earth, taking the form of a cow, exceedingly wretched and oppressed by her heavy burden, went for refuge to Brahma.'

Verse 3 (devibhagavatam.6.11.3)

वेधसा प्रार्थितो विष्णुः कमलापतिरीश्वरः । भूभारोत्तारणार्थाय साधूनां रक्षणाय च

vedhasā prārthito viṣṇuḥ kamalāpatirīśvaraḥ | bhūbhārottāraṇārthāya sādhūnāṁ rakṣaṇāya ca

'The creator entreated Vishnu, lord and husband of Lakshmi, for the sake of relieving the earth's burden and protecting the righteous.'

Verse 4 (devibhagavatam.6.11.4)

भगवन् भारते खण्डे देवैः सह जनार्दन । अवतारं गृहाणाशु वसुदेवगृहे विभो

bhagavan bhārate khaṇḍe devaiḥ saha janārdana | avatāraṁ gṛhāṇāśu vasudevagṛhe vibho

'O blessed one, O Janardana, take incarnation swiftly, together with the gods, in the land of Bharata, in the house of Vasudeva, O mighty one.'

Verse 5 (devibhagavatam.6.11.5)

एवं सम्प्रार्थितो धात्रा भगवान्देवकीसुतः । बभूव सह रामेण भूभारोत्तारणाय वै

evaṁ samprārthito dhātrā bhagavāndevakīsutaḥ | babhūva saha rāmeṇa bhūbhārottāraṇāya vai

Thus entreated by the creator, the blessed one became the son of Devaki, together with Rama (Balarama), for the very purpose of relieving the earth of her burden.

Verse 6 (devibhagavatam.6.11.6)

कियानुत्तारितो भारो हत्वा दुष्टाननेकशः । ज्ञात्वा सर्वान्दुराचारान्पापबुद्धिनृपानिह

kiyānuttārito bhāro hatvā duṣṭānanekaśaḥ | jñātvā sarvāndurācārānpāpabuddhinṛpāniha

'How much of that burden was truly relieved, having slain the wicked so many times over, and having identified here all the evil-conducted, sinful-minded kings —'

Verse 7 (devibhagavatam.6.11.7)

हतो भीष्मो हतो द्रोणो विराटो द्रुपदस्तथा । बाह्लीकः सोमदत्तश्च कर्णो वैकर्तनस्तथा

hato bhīṣmo hato droṇo virāṭo drupadastathā | bāhlīkaḥ somadattaśca karṇo vaikartanastathā

'— Bhishma was slain, Drona was slain, and so were Virata and Drupada; Bahlika and Somadatta, and Karna, son of Vikartana —'

Verse 8 (devibhagavatam.6.11.8)

यैर्लुण्ठितं धनं सर्वं हृताश्च हरियोषितः । कथं न नाशिता दुष्टा ये स्थिताः पृथिवीतले

yairluṇṭhitaṁ dhanaṁ sarvaṁ hṛtāśca hariyoṣitaḥ | kathaṁ na nāśitā duṣṭā ye sthitāḥ pṛthivītale

'— slain, by whom all wealth had been plundered and Hari's women carried off — why then were the wicked who still remained upon the earth not destroyed?'

Verse 9 (devibhagavatam.6.11.9)

आभीराश्च शका म्लेच्छा निषादाः कोटिशस्तथा । भारावतरणं किं तत्कृतं कृष्णेन धीमता

ābhīrāśca śakā mlecchā niṣādāḥ koṭiśastathā | bhārāvataraṇaṁ kiṁ tatkṛtaṁ kṛṣṇena dhīmatā

'The Abhiras, Shakas, mlecchas, and Nishadas remained by the millions — was the earth's burden truly relieved by the wise Krishna?'

Verse 10 (devibhagavatam.6.11.10)

सन्देहोऽयं महाभाग न निवर्तति चित्ततः । कलावस्मिन्मजाः सर्वाः पश्यतः पापनिश्चयाः

sandeho'yaṁ mahābhāga na nivartati cittataḥ | kalāvasminmajāḥ sarvāḥ paśyataḥ pāpaniścayāḥ

'This doubt, O greatly fortunate one, will not leave my mind, seeing all the beings born in this Kali age so firmly resolved upon sin.'

Verse 11 (devibhagavatam.6.11.11)

व्यास उवाच । राजन् यस्मिन्युगे यादृक्प्रजा भवति कालतः । नान्यथा तद्भवेन्नूनं युगधर्मोऽत्र कारणम्

vyāsa uvāca | rājan yasminyuge yādṛkprajā bhavati kālataḥ | nānyathā tadbhavennūnaṁ yugadharmo'tra kāraṇam

Vyasa said: 'O king, in whatever yuga, the people born by the force of time are of a certain nature, and it cannot be otherwise — the dharma of that yuga is the cause of it.'

Verse 12 (devibhagavatam.6.11.12)

ये धर्मरसिका जीवास्ते वै सत्ययुगेऽभवन् । धर्मार्थरसिका ये तु ते वै त्रेतायुगेऽभवन्

ye dharmarasikā jīvāste vai satyayuge'bhavan | dharmārtharasikā ye tu te vai tretāyuge'bhavan

'Those beings who delighted purely in dharma existed in the Satya Yuga; those who delighted in both dharma and artha existed in the Treta Yuga.'

Verse 13 (devibhagavatam.6.11.13)

धर्मार्थकामरसिका द्वापरे चाभवन्युगे । अर्थकामपराः सर्वे कलावस्मिन्भवन्ति हि

dharmārthakāmarasikā dvāpare cābhavanyuge | arthakāmaparāḥ sarve kalāvasminbhavanti hi

'Those who delighted in dharma, artha, and kama together existed in the Dvapara age; and all who are devoted only to artha and kama exist here in this Kali age.'

Verse 14 (devibhagavatam.6.11.14)

युगधर्मस्तु राजेन्द्र न याति व्यत्ययं पुनः । कालः कर्तास्ति धर्मस्य ह्यधर्मस्य च वै पुनः

yugadharmastu rājendra na yāti vyatyayaṁ punaḥ | kālaḥ kartāsti dharmasya hyadharmasya ca vai punaḥ

'The dharma of the yuga, O king of kings, never turns from its course; time itself is the maker of dharma, and likewise of adharma.'

Verse 15 (devibhagavatam.6.11.15)

राजोवाच । ये तु सत्ययुगे जीवा भवन्ति धर्मतत्पराः । कुत्र तेऽद्य महाभाग तिष्ठन्ति पुण्यभागिनः

rājovāca | ye tu satyayuge jīvā bhavanti dharmatatparāḥ | kutra te'dya mahābhāga tiṣṭhanti puṇyabhāginaḥ

The king said: 'Those beings who lived in the Satya Yuga, devoted to dharma — where, O greatly fortunate one, do they now dwell, those who shared in that merit?'

Verse 16 (devibhagavatam.6.11.16)

त्रेतायुगे द्वापरे वा ये दानव्रतकारकाः । वर्तन्ते मुनयः श्रेष्ठाः कुत्र ब्रूहि पितामह

tretāyuge dvāpare vā ye dānavratakārakāḥ | vartante munayaḥ śreṣṭhāḥ kutra brūhi pitāmaha

'And those who, in Treta or Dvapara, performed acts of charity and undertook vows — where do those finest sages now exist? Tell me, O grandfather.'

Verse 17 (devibhagavatam.6.11.17)

कलावद्य दुराचारा येऽत्र सन्ति गतत्रपाः । आद्ये युगे क्व यास्यन्ति पापिष्ठा देवनिन्दकाः

kalāvadya durācārā ye'tra santi gatatrapāḥ | ādye yuge kva yāsyanti pāpiṣṭhā devanindakāḥ

'And those evil-conducted, shameless beings who exist here today in the Kali age — where shall these most sinful blasphemers of the gods go when the first age (Satya) returns?'

Verse 18 (devibhagavatam.6.11.18)

एतत्सर्वं समाचक्ष्व विस्तरेण महामते । सर्वथा श्रोतुकामोऽस्मि यदेतद्धर्मनिर्णयम्

etatsarvaṁ samācakṣva vistareṇa mahāmate | sarvathā śrotukāmo'smi yadetaddharmanirṇayam

'Tell me all of this in full detail, O wise one; I am eager in every way to hear this determination concerning dharma.'

Verse 19 (devibhagavatam.6.11.19)

व्यास उवाच । ये वै कृतयुगे राजन् सम्भवन्तीह मानवाः । कृत्वा ते पुण्यकर्माणि देवलोकान्व्रजन्ति वै

vyāsa uvāca | ye vai kṛtayuge rājan sambhavantīha mānavāḥ | kṛtvā te puṇyakarmāṇi devalokānvrajanti vai

Vyasa said: 'Those men, O king, who are born here in the Krita Yuga, having performed meritorious deeds, indeed go on to the worlds of the gods.'

Verse 20 (devibhagavatam.6.11.20)

ब्राह्मणाः क्षत्रिया वैश्याः शूद्राश्च नृपसत्तम । स्वधर्मनिरता यान्ति लोकान्कर्मजितान्किल

brāhmaṇāḥ kṣatriyā vaiśyāḥ śūdrāśca nṛpasattama | svadharmaniratā yānti lokānkarmajitānkila

'Brahmins, kshatriyas, vaishyas, and shudras, O best of kings, devoted to their own respective dharma, indeed attain the worlds won by their own deeds.'

Verse 21 (devibhagavatam.6.11.21)

सत्यं दया तथा दानं स्वदारगमनं तथा । अद्रोहः सर्वभूतेषु समता सर्वजन्तुषु

satyaṁ dayā tathā dānaṁ svadāragamanaṁ tathā | adrohaḥ sarvabhūteṣu samatā sarvajantuṣu

'Truthfulness, compassion, and charity likewise, and fidelity to one's own wife; freedom from malice toward all beings, and equanimity toward every creature —'

Verse 22 (devibhagavatam.6.11.22)

एतत्साधारणं धर्मं कृत्वा सत्ययुगे पुनः । स्वर्गं यान्तीतरे वर्णा धर्मतो रजकादयः

etatsādhāraṇaṁ dharmaṁ kṛtvā satyayuge punaḥ | svargaṁ yāntītare varṇā dharmato rajakādayaḥ

'— performing this common dharma in the Satya Yuga, even the other classes — washermen and the like — go to heaven through their righteousness.'

Verse 23 (devibhagavatam.6.11.23)

तथा त्रेतायुगे राजन् द्वापरेऽथ युगे तथा । कलावस्मिन्युगे पापा नरकं यान्ति मानवाः

tathā tretāyuge rājan dvāpare'tha yuge tathā | kalāvasminyuge pāpā narakaṁ yānti mānavāḥ

'Likewise, O king, in the Treta Yuga, and in the Dvapara age, and in this Kali age too, sinful men go to hell.'

Verse 24 (devibhagavatam.6.11.24)

तावत्तिष्ठन्ति ते तत्र यावत्स्याद्युगपर्ययः । पुनश्च मानुषे लोके भवन्ति भुवि मानवाः

tāvattiṣṭhanti te tatra yāvatsyādyugaparyayaḥ | punaśca mānuṣe loke bhavanti bhuvi mānavāḥ

'They remain there for as long as the yuga has yet to turn; and then, once again, they are born as men in this world upon the earth.'

Verse 25 (devibhagavatam.6.11.25)

यदा सत्ययुगस्यादिः कलेरन्तश्च पार्थिव । तदा स्वर्गात्पुण्यकृतो जायन्ते किल मानवाः

yadā satyayugasyādiḥ kalerantaśca pārthiva | tadā svargātpuṇyakṛto jāyante kila mānavāḥ

'When the beginning of the Satya Yuga arrives and the Kali Yuga comes to its end, O king, then those of merit are born as men, descending from heaven.'

Verse 26 (devibhagavatam.6.11.26)

यदा कलियुगस्यादिर्द्वापरस्य क्षयस्तथा । नरकात्पापिनः सर्वे भवन्ति भुवि मानवाः

yadā kaliyugasyādirdvāparasya kṣayastathā | narakātpāpinaḥ sarve bhavanti bhuvi mānavāḥ

'When the Kali Yuga begins, and likewise Dvapara comes to its close, all the sinful are born as men on earth, come up from hell.'

Verse 27 (devibhagavatam.6.11.27)

एवं कालसमाचारो नान्यथाभूत्कदाचन । तस्मात्कलिरसत्कर्ता तस्मिंस्तु तादृशी प्रजा

evaṁ kālasamācāro nānyathābhūtkadācana | tasmātkalirasatkartā tasmiṁstu tādṛśī prajā

'Such is the ordinary course of time; it has never once been otherwise. Therefore Kali is the maker of the wicked, and the people born within it are of just that nature.'

Verse 28 (devibhagavatam.6.11.28)

कदाचिद्दैवयोगात्तु प्राणिनां व्यत्ययो भवेत् । कलौ ये साधवः केचिद्द्वापरे सम्भवन्ति ते

kadāciddaivayogāttu prāṇināṁ vyatyayo bhavet | kalau ye sādhavaḥ keciddvāpare sambhavanti te

'Yet occasionally, through the workings of fate, an exception occurs among living beings; the few virtuous ones found in Kali are those who carry over from Dvapara.'

Verse 29 (devibhagavatam.6.11.29)

तथा त्रेतायुगे केचित्केचित्सत्ययुगे तथा । दुष्टाः सत्ययुगे ये तु ते भवन्ति कलावपि

tathā tretāyuge kecitkecitsatyayuge tathā | duṣṭāḥ satyayuge ye tu te bhavanti kalāvapi

'Likewise, some carry over from Treta, and some even from Satya Yuga; and those who were wicked even in Satya Yuga are found present even in Kali.'

Verse 30 (devibhagavatam.6.11.30)

कृतकर्मप्रभावेण प्राप्नुवन्त्यसुखानि च । पुनश्च तादृशं कर्म कुर्वन्ति युगभावतः

kṛtakarmaprabhāveṇa prāpnuvantyasukhāni ca | punaśca tādṛśaṁ karma kurvanti yugabhāvataḥ

'Through the influence of deeds already performed, they come to experience sorrows; and, under the sway of the yuga's own nature, they perform similar deeds once again.'

Verse 31 (devibhagavatam.6.11.31)

जनमेजय उवाच । युगधर्मान्महाभाग ब्रूहि सर्वानशेषतः । यस्मिन्वै यादृशो धर्मो ज्ञातुमिच्छामि तं तथा

janamejaya uvāca | yugadharmānmahābhāga brūhi sarvānaśeṣataḥ | yasminvai yādṛśo dharmo jñātumicchāmi taṁ tathā

Janamejaya said: 'O greatly fortunate one, tell me all the dharmas belonging to the yugas, in their entirety; I wish to know precisely what dharma governs each one.'

Verse 32 (devibhagavatam.6.11.32)

व्यास उवाच । निबोध नृपशार्दूल दृष्टान्तं ते ब्रवीम्यहम् । साधूनामपि चेतांसि युगभावाद्भ्रमन्ति हि

vyāsa uvāca | nibodha nṛpaśārdūla dṛṣṭāntaṁ te bravīmyaham | sādhūnāmapi cetāṁsi yugabhāvādbhramanti hi

Vyasa said: 'Understand this, O tiger among kings; I shall give you an illustration. Even the minds of the virtuous can indeed be led astray by the very nature of the yuga.'

Verse 33 (devibhagavatam.6.11.33)

पितुर्यथा ते राजेन्द्र वुद्धिर्विप्रावहेलने । कृता वै कलिना राजन् धर्मज्ञस्य महात्मनः

pituryathā te rājendra vuddhirviprāvahelane | kṛtā vai kalinā rājan dharmajñasya mahātmanaḥ

'Just as, O king of kings, your own father's mind was led into disrespect toward a brahmin — this indeed, O king, was brought about by Kali, even in that great-souled, dharma-knowing man.'

Verse 34 (devibhagavatam.6.11.34)

अन्यथा क्षत्रियो राजा ययातिकुलसम्भवः । तापसस्य गले सर्पं मृतं कस्मादयोजयत्

anyathā kṣatriyo rājā yayātikulasambhavaḥ | tāpasasya gale sarpaṁ mṛtaṁ kasmādayojayat

'Otherwise, how could that kshatriya king, born of the line of Yayati, have placed a dead serpent around the neck of an ascetic?'

Verse 35 (devibhagavatam.6.11.35)

सर्वं युगबलं राजन्वेदितव्यं विजानता । प्रयत्नेन हि कर्तव्यं धर्मकर्म विशेषतः

sarvaṁ yugabalaṁ rājanveditavyaṁ vijānatā | prayatnena hi kartavyaṁ dharmakarma viśeṣataḥ

'All this, O king, is to be understood by the discerning as the power of the yuga at work; therefore, righteous deeds must be undertaken with all the more effort and care.'

Verse 36 (devibhagavatam.6.11.36)

नूनं सत्ययुगे राजन् ब्राह्मणा वेदपारगाः । पराशक्त्यर्चनरता देवीदर्शनलालसाः

nūnaṁ satyayuge rājan brāhmaṇā vedapāragāḥ | parāśaktyarcanaratā devīdarśanalālasāḥ

'Surely, O king, in the Satya Yuga, the brahmins were fully versed in the Vedas, devoted to the worship of the Supreme Shakti, and eager for the vision of the Goddess.'

Verse 37 (devibhagavatam.6.11.37)

गायत्रीप्रणवासक्ता गायत्रीध्यानकारिणः । गायत्रीजपसंसक्ता मायाबीजैकजापिनः

gāyatrīpraṇavāsaktā gāyatrīdhyānakāriṇaḥ | gāyatrījapasaṁsaktā māyābījaikajāpinaḥ

'— devoted to the Gayatri and to Pranava, absorbed in meditation on Gayatri, engaged constantly in Gayatri recitation, single-minded repeaters of the maya-seed mantra —'

Verse 38 (devibhagavatam.6.11.38)

ग्रामे ग्रामे पराम्बायाः प्रासादकरणोत्सुकाः । स्वकर्मनिरताः सर्वे सत्यशौचदयान्विताः

grāme grāme parāmbāyāḥ prāsādakaraṇotsukāḥ | svakarmaniratāḥ sarve satyaśaucadayānvitāḥ

'— eager to build temples for the Supreme Mother in village after village; all devoted to their own respective duties, endowed with truth, purity, and compassion.'

Verse 39 (devibhagavatam.6.11.39)

त्रय्युक्तकर्मनिरतास्तत्त्वज्ञानविशारदाः । अभवन्क्षत्रियास्तत्र प्रजाभरणतत्पराः

trayyuktakarmaniratāstattvajñānaviśāradāḥ | abhavankṣatriyāstatra prajābharaṇatatparāḥ

'Devoted to the deeds enjoined by the threefold Veda, skilled in knowledge of the truth; the kshatriyas of that age were devoted to the nurture and protection of their people.'

Verse 40 (devibhagavatam.6.11.40)

वैश्यास्तु कृषिवाणिज्यगोसेवानिरतास्तथा । शूद्राः सेवापरास्तत्र पुण्ये सत्ययुगे नृप

vaiśyāstu kṛṣivāṇijyagosevāniratāstathā | śūdrāḥ sevāparāstatra puṇye satyayuge nṛpa

'The vaishyas were devoted to farming, trade, and the tending of cattle; and the shudras, O king, in that meritorious Satya Yuga, were devoted to service.'

Verse 41 (devibhagavatam.6.11.41)

पराम्बापूजनासक्ताः सर्वे वर्णाः परे युगे । तथा त्रेतायुगे किञ्चिन्न्यूना धर्मस्य संस्थितिः

parāmbāpūjanāsaktāḥ sarve varṇāḥ pare yuge | tathā tretāyuge kiñcinnyūnā dharmasya saṁsthitiḥ

'In that first age, all the classes were devoted to the worship of the Supreme Mother. In the Treta Yuga, similarly, the standing of dharma had somewhat diminished.'

Verse 42 (devibhagavatam.6.11.42)

द्वापरे च विशेषेण न्यूना सत्ययुगस्थितिः । पूर्वं ये राक्षसा राजन् ते कलौ ब्राह्मणाः स्मृताः

dvāpare ca viśeṣeṇa nyūnā satyayugasthitiḥ | pūrvaṁ ye rākṣasā rājan te kalau brāhmaṇāḥ smṛtāḥ

'And in Dvapara, the condition of the Satya Yuga had declined still further; those who were rakshasas in earlier ages, O king, are remembered as brahmins now in Kali.'

Verse 43 (devibhagavatam.6.11.43)

पाखण्डनिरताः प्रायो भवन्ति जनवञ्चकाः । असत्यवादिनः सर्वे वेदधर्मविवर्जिताः

pākhaṇḍaniratāḥ prāyo bhavanti janavañcakāḥ | asatyavādinaḥ sarve vedadharmavivarjitāḥ

'They are mostly given over to heresy, deceivers of the people; all speakers of falsehood, and utterly devoid of Vedic dharma.'

Verse 44 (devibhagavatam.6.11.44)

दाम्भिका लोकचतुरा मानिनो वेदवर्जिताः । शूद्रसेवापराः केचिन्नानाधर्मप्रवर्तकाः

dāmbhikā lokacaturā mānino vedavarjitāḥ | śūdrasevāparāḥ kecinnānādharmapravartakāḥ

'Hypocritical, worldly-wise in cunning, proud, devoid of the Veda; some devoted to serving shudras, and propagators of countless false doctrines.'

Verse 45 (devibhagavatam.6.11.45)

वेदनिन्दाकराः क्रूरा धर्मभ्रष्टातिवादुकाः । यथा यथा कलिर्वृद्धिं याति राजंस्तथा तथा

vedanindākarāḥ krūrā dharmabhraṣṭātivādukāḥ | yathā yathā kalirvṛddhiṁ yāti rājaṁstathā tathā

'Reviling the Veda, cruel, fallen from dharma, endlessly given to disputation; and, O king, as Kali continues to grow, this condition worsens still further.'

Verse 46 (devibhagavatam.6.11.46)

धर्मस्य सत्यमूलस्य क्षयः सर्वात्मना भवेत् । तथैव क्षत्रिया वैश्याः शूद्राश्च धर्मवर्जिताः

dharmasya satyamūlasya kṣayaḥ sarvātmanā bhavet | tathaiva kṣatriyā vaiśyāḥ śūdrāśca dharmavarjitāḥ

'The decay of dharma, whose very root is truth, becomes complete in every respect; and likewise the kshatriyas, vaishyas, and shudras become altogether devoid of dharma.'

Verse 47 (devibhagavatam.6.11.47)

असत्यवादिनः पापास्तथा वर्णेतराः कलौ । शूद्रधर्मरता विप्राः प्रतिग्रहपरायणाः

asatyavādinaḥ pāpāstathā varṇetarāḥ kalau | śūdradharmaratā viprāḥ pratigrahaparāyaṇāḥ

'Speakers of falsehood, sinful, and even those outside the fourfold order in Kali; brahmins devoted to the ways of shudras, intent only on accepting gifts.'

Verse 48 (devibhagavatam.6.11.48)

भविष्यन्ति कलौ राजन् युगे वृद्धिं गताः किल । कामचाराः स्त्रियः कामलोभमोहसमन्विताः

bhaviṣyanti kalau rājan yuge vṛddhiṁ gatāḥ kila | kāmacārāḥ striyaḥ kāmalobhamohasamanvitāḥ

'These things shall come to pass, O king, as the Kali age advances toward its fullness; women shall act however they please, filled with desire, greed, and delusion.'

Verse 49 (devibhagavatam.6.11.49)

पापा मिथ्याभिवादिन्यः सदा क्लेशरता नृप । स्वभर्तृवञ्जका नित्यं धर्मभाषणपण्डिताः

pāpā mithyābhivādinyaḥ sadā kleśaratā nṛpa | svabhartṛvañjakā nityaṁ dharmabhāṣaṇapaṇḍitāḥ

'Sinful, given to falsehood, ever prone to quarreling, O king; constantly deceiving their own husbands, yet skilled at speaking learnedly of dharma.'

Verse 50 (devibhagavatam.6.11.50)

भवन्त्येवंविधा नार्यः पापिष्ठाश्च कलौ युगे । आहारशुद्।ह्ध्या नृपते चित्तशुद्धिस्तु जायते

bhavantyevaṁvidhā nāryaḥ pāpiṣṭhāśca kalau yuge | āhāraśud|hdhyā nṛpate cittaśuddhistu jāyate

'Such women, most sinful, shall exist in the Kali age. Through purity of food, O king, purity of mind is truly born.'

Verse 51 (devibhagavatam.6.11.51)

शुद्धे चित्ते प्रकाशः स्याद्धर्मस्य नृपसत्तम । वृत्तसङ्करदोषेण जायते धर्मसङ्करः

śuddhe citte prakāśaḥ syāddharmasya nṛpasattama | vṛttasaṅkaradoṣeṇa jāyate dharmasaṅkaraḥ

'With a purified mind, the very light of dharma appears, O best of kings; but through the fault of mixed conduct, a mixing of dharma comes into being.'

Verse 52 (devibhagavatam.6.11.52)

धर्मस्य सङ्करे जाते नूनं स्याद्वर्णसङ्करः । एवं कलियुगे भूप सर्वधर्मविवर्जिते

dharmasya saṅkare jāte nūnaṁ syādvarṇasaṅkaraḥ | evaṁ kaliyuge bhūpa sarvadharmavivarjite

'When dharma has become mixed, an intermingling of the classes surely results. Thus, O king, in the Kali age, bereft of all dharma —'

Verse 53 (devibhagavatam.6.11.53)

स्ववर्णधर्मवार्तैषा न कुत्राप्युपलभ्यते । महान्तोऽपि च धर्मज्ञा अधर्मं कुर्वते नृप

svavarṇadharmavārtaiṣā na kutrāpyupalabhyate | mahānto'pi ca dharmajñā adharmaṁ kurvate nṛpa

'— this very knowledge of one's own class-duty is found nowhere at all; even great, dharma-knowing men commit adharma, O king.'

Verse 54 (devibhagavatam.6.11.54)

कलिस्वभाव एवैष परिहार्यो न केनचित् । तस्मादत्र मनुष्याणां स्वभावात्पापकारिणाम्

kalisvabhāva evaiṣa parihāryo na kenacit | tasmādatra manuṣyāṇāṁ svabhāvātpāpakāriṇām

'This is simply the very nature of Kali itself, which no one at all can avoid; therefore, for men here, who by their very nature turn to sin —'

Verse 55 (devibhagavatam.6.11.55)

निष्कृतिर्न हि राजेन्द्र सामान्योपायतो भवेत् । जनमेजय उवाच । भगवन्सर्वधर्मज्ञ सर्वशास्त्रविशारद

niṣkṛtirna hi rājendra sāmānyopāyato bhavet | janamejaya uvāca | bhagavansarvadharmajña sarvaśāstraviśārada

'— there is, O king of kings, no expiation to be had through ordinary means at all.' Janamejaya said: 'O blessed one, knower of all dharma, learned in every scripture —'

Verse 56 (devibhagavatam.6.11.56)

कलावधर्मबहुले नराणां का गतिर्भवेत् । यद्यस्ति तदुपायश्चेद्दयया तं वदस्व मे

kalāvadharmabahule narāṇāṁ kā gatirbhavet | yadyasti tadupāyaśceddayayā taṁ vadasva me

'— in this Kali age, so overrun with adharma, what recourse remains for mankind? If there is any means, tell it to me, out of your compassion.'

Verse 57 (devibhagavatam.6.11.57)

व्यास उवाच । एक एव महाराज तत्रोपायोऽस्ति नापरः । सर्वदोषनिरासार्थं ध्यायेद्देवीपदाम्बुजम्

vyāsa uvāca | eka eva mahārāja tatropāyo'sti nāparaḥ | sarvadoṣanirāsārthaṁ dhyāyeddevīpadāmbujam

Vyasa said: 'There is, O great king, one single remedy for this, and no other; for the removal of every fault, one should meditate upon the lotus feet of the Goddess.'

Verse 58 (devibhagavatam.6.11.58)

न सन्त्यघानि तावन्ति यावती शक्तिरस्ति हि । नास्ति देव्याः पापदाहे तस्माद्भीतिः कुतो नृप

na santyaghāni tāvanti yāvatī śaktirasti hi | nāsti devyāḥ pāpadāhe tasmādbhītiḥ kuto nṛpa

'Sins are not as numerous as the power that truly exists to counter them; the Goddess feels no hesitation whatsoever in burning away sin — so from where, O king, could any fear arise?'

Verse 59 (devibhagavatam.6.11.59)

अवशेनापि यन्नाम लीलयोच्चारितं यदि । किं किं ददाति तज्ज्ञातुं समर्था न हरादयः

avaśenāpi yannāma līlayoccāritaṁ yadi | kiṁ kiṁ dadāti tajjñātuṁ samarthā na harādayaḥ

'If her very name is uttered even unintentionally, even in mere play, what it grants — even Hara and the other gods are not capable of fully knowing.'

Verse 60 (devibhagavatam.6.11.60)

प्रायश्चित्तं तु पापानां श्रीदेवीनामसंस्मृतिः । तस्मात्कलिभयाद्राजन् पुण्यक्षेत्रे वसेन्नरः

prāyaścittaṁ tu pāpānāṁ śrīdevīnāmasaṁsmṛtiḥ | tasmātkalibhayādrājan puṇyakṣetre vasennaraḥ

'The true expiation for sins is simply the remembrance of Shri Devi's name; therefore, out of fear of Kali, O king, a man should dwell in a sacred place.'

Verse 61 (devibhagavatam.6.11.61)

निरन्तरं पराम्बाया नामसंस्मरणं चरेत् । छित्त्वा भित्त्वा च भूतानि हत्वा सर्वमिदं जगत्

nirantaraṁ parāmbāyā nāmasaṁsmaraṇaṁ caret | chittvā bhittvā ca bhūtāni hatvā sarvamidaṁ jagat

'One should continually engage in remembrance of the Supreme Mother's name; even one who has cut down, shattered, and destroyed this entire world —'

Verse 62 (devibhagavatam.6.11.62)

देवीं नमति भक्त्या यो न स पापैर्विलिप्यते । रहस्यं सर्वशास्त्राणां मया राजन्नुदीरितम्

devīṁ namati bhaktyā yo na sa pāpairvilipyate | rahasyaṁ sarvaśāstrāṇāṁ mayā rājannudīritam

'— if he bows to the Goddess with devotion, he is not stained by his sins at all. This secret truth of all the scriptures, O king, has now been declared by me.'

Verse 63 (devibhagavatam.6.11.63)

विमृश्यैतदशेषेण भज देवीपदाम्बुजम् । अजपां नाम गायत्रीं जपन्ति निखिला जनाः

vimṛśyaitadaśeṣeṇa bhaja devīpadāmbujam | ajapāṁ nāma gāyatrīṁ japanti nikhilā janāḥ

'Having weighed this fully, devote yourself to the lotus feet of the Goddess. All people recite the Gayatri known as Ajapa, the "unrecited" recitation —'

Verse 64 (devibhagavatam.6.11.64)

महिमानं न जानन्ति मायाया वैभवं महत् । गायत्रीं ब्राह्मणाः सर्वे जपन्ति हृदयान्तरे

mahimānaṁ na jānanti māyāyā vaibhavaṁ mahat | gāyatrīṁ brāhmaṇāḥ sarve japanti hṛdayāntare

'— yet they do not know its greatness, the vast glory hidden within that maya. All brahmins recite the Gayatri deep within their own hearts —'

Verse 65 (devibhagavatam.6.11.65)

महिमानं न जानन्ति मायाया वैभवं महत् । एतत्सर्वं समाख्यातं यत्पृष्टं तत्त्वया नृप । युगधर्मव्यवस्थायां किं भूयः श्रोतुमिच्छसि

mahimānaṁ na jānanti māyāyā vaibhavaṁ mahat | etatsarvaṁ samākhyātaṁ yatpṛṣṭaṁ tattvayā nṛpa | yugadharmavyavasthāyāṁ kiṁ bhūyaḥ śrotumicchasi

'— yet they do not know its greatness, the great glory of that maya. All this, O king, whatever you asked of me, has now been fully told; what more do you wish to hear concerning the ordinance of the dharma of the yugas?'
